It took me 2 days to defrost myself from the magnificent horrible adventure that is this book. It was a rollercoaster, a more scary one. I loved the characters and the plot, despite me wishing a little more world-building was done. The creativity and imagery used to describe the monsters was wonderful. I also loved the little poetry sections of the book, it added mysterious touch to the book. This is definitly a good read if you like fantasy/dystopians. Also the morality of each character was so well written, I truly doubted the black/white ideals of the society. Also, I love Kate as a character.
